Six Judges Appointed as Permanent Judges of Kerala High Court

Six additional judges have been appointed as permanent judges of the Kerala High Court, strengthening the judiciary and enhancing its capacity to address case backlogs while ensuring continuity and stability in the state’s legal system.

Kerala: In a significant development for the judiciary, six judges have been elevated as permanent judges of the Kerala High Court. The move reinforces the court’s institutional stability and judicial capacity, reports Dynamite News correspondent.

Names of the Appointed Judges

The judges appointed as permanent members of the bench are:

  1. Justice Mullappally Abdul Aziz Abdul Hakhim

  2. Justice Syam Kumar Vadakke Mudavakkat

  3. Justice Harisankar Vijayan Menon

  4. Justice Manu Sreedharan Nair

  5. Justice Manoj Pulamby Madhavan

  6. Justice Marakkaparambil Bhargavan Snehalatha

Impact on Judicial Efficiency

The confirmation of these judges to permanent positions is expected to enhance the court’s ability to manage caseloads effectively. Strengthening the bench plays a crucial role in reducing pendency and ensuring timely justice delivery across Kerala.
